HASH BROWNS MAKEOVER
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Categories side-dish
Time 28m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Grate the potatoes, with their skin into a large bowl. Peel and grate the parsnip; add to the potatoes. Toss the vegetables with the scallions, parsley and season with the salt and pepper, to taste.
- Heat a large (12-inch) nonstick skillet over medium heat and brush the skillet with about half the oil. Add the potato mixture and form into an even cake by pressing lightly with a spatula. Cook, shaking the pan periodically to prevent sticking, until the hash browns are crisp and brown, about 10 minutes.
- Remove the pan from the heat; place a flat plate over the top of the skillet. Carefully flip the pan so the potato cake goes onto the plate. Brush the skillet with the remaining olive oil and then side the hash browns back into the skillet. Cook until browned and crisp, about 10 minutes more. Slide out of the skillet onto a heated serving plate. Cut into wedges to serve.

HASH BROWN PATTY AU GRATIN
I got this recipe from a 1987 Cookbook Digest. This recipe is just right for one or two people. Use a frozen hash brown patty to make this tasty potato dish. Easy enough for a teenager or preteen to make. You can add other things to your liking. Fresh chives or cheddar cheese instead of Parmesan cheese is good also.
Provided by Catnip46
Categories Lunch/Snacks
Time 8m
Yield 1-2 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Combine hash brown patty, milk, margarine, onion, salt, and pepper in 1-quart microwave-safe casserole. Cover with casserole lid.
- microwave (high) 4-5 minutes or until potatoes are partially thawed, stirring once. Stir in Parmesan cheese.
- Microwave (high) 4-5 minutes or until hot and bubbly, stirring once. Sprinkle with parsley and paprika.

HASH BROWNS AU GRATIN
Read on to find out how you can start with a package of frozen hash browns-and end up with this creamy, cheesy au gratin side dish.
Provided by My Food and Family
Categories Home
Time 25m
Yield 8 servings, 1/2 cup each
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Heat dressing in large skillet on medium heat. Add onions; cook and stir 1 to 2 min. or until onions are crisp-tender.
- Stir in potatoes; cover. Simmer on medium-low heat 10 min. or until potatoes are tender, stirring occasionally.
- Add sour cream, Neufchatel and 1/4 cup cheddar; stir until cheddar is melted and mixture is well blended. Top with remaining cheddar; cover. Cook 5 min. or until melted.
